It’s big because it’s a rivalry clash.

It’s crucial because it could mean increasing a first-place lead in an air-tight conference.

It’s important because it could mean six wins in a row over the foe from Tucson.

But Saturday’s ASU-UA men’s basketball game at Wells Fargo Arena means much more than all those things.

The reason? Sun Devil Nation needs something to get excited about.

Let’s face it — the fall sports season in Tempe was difficult to bear. It clearly started on the gridiron, where ASU suffered through its second straight losing season, leaving the Maroon and Gold faithful to pull out hair and wonder where everything went wrong.

After strong starts to their seasons, the school’s volleyball and soccer teams also struggled down the stretch.

But as the saying goes, hope springs eternal, and the spring semester is upon us.

New season. New sports. New reasons to be excited.

This weekend’s rivalry tilt could be a great way to awake from the winter break doldrums and work out the vocal chords.

The Sun Devils are currently in first place in the Pac-10, and with a conference as unpredictable as a Ron Artest sound bite, the squad has its sights set on the title.

Sounds like something to get excited about.
